IPOB gets over $160,000 via monthly dues, crowdfunding – NFIU

The Nigerian Financial Intelligence Unit, NFIU, has said the Indigenous People of Biafra, IPOB, raised over $160,000 through monthly dues and crowdfunding efforts. NFIU disclosed this in its recent publication, ‘Counter Terrorism Financial Newsletter’. Senate Confirms Hafsat Bakari as Director Nigeria Financial Intelligence Unit

The Senate on Tuesday confirmed the appointment of Hafsat Bakari as Director of the Nigerian Financial Intelligence Unit, NFIU. The confirmation followed a report submitted to the Chamber by the Senate Committee Chairman on Anti-corruption and Financial Crimes, Emmanuel Memga Undende.
